mirage / functoria

A DSL to invoke otherworldly functors
ISC License
63 stars 21 forks source link

Fix equality for 'a impl values #188

Closed samoht closed 4 years ago

samoht commented 4 years ago

This fixes random issues with mirage configure when multiple keys sharing the same name. Replaces #187

Drup commented 4 years ago

I'm pretty sure that was initially on purpose so that we could share the module implementation of configurable, even if they are instanciated twice with different key names, and it seems that was not a good idea at all. Well spotted, feel free to merge. :)